Leipzig/Halle and Dresden Airports start 2017 with positive developments in traffic

The two commercial airports operated by Mitteldeutsche Flughafen AG, Leipzig/Halle and Dresden International, recorded positive developments in the first month of the year. 210,895 passengers in all passed through the two airports, an increase of 5.5 percent over the figure for the same period in the previous year.

Dresden Airport registered 99,783 passengers during the first month of the year. This corresponded to an increase of 7.5 percent over 2016. Scheduled services on domestic and international routes developed in a particularly encouraging manner.

The number of passengers at Leipzig/Halle Airport increased by 3.8 percent in January to a figure of 111,112 compared to the same month in the previous year. In addition to domestic services, tourist traffic grew positively – apart from routes to Turkey. There were increases on the services to Egypt, Morocco, Spain and Portugal. Cargo volumes also continued to develop in an encouraging manner at Europe’s fifth largest freight airport. The amount handled at Leipzig/Halle rose by 6.9 percent to approx. 84,782 tonnes at the beginning of the year.
